Why Zinc Gluconate for Immune Support?
Zinc is a vital mineral that supports various immune functions. Zinc gluconate is a popular form due to its excellent absorption and gentle effect on the stomach. Key benefits include:
– Boosts Immune Function – Zinc helps activate white blood cells, which defend against infections.
– Reduces Cold Duration – Studies show that zinc gluconate can shorten the duration of colds when taken early.
– Antioxidant Properties – It combats oxidative stress, protecting cells from damage.
– Supports Wound Healing – Zinc aids in tissue repair, enhancing recovery from illness.
How to Use Zinc Gluconate for Immunity
For optimal immune support, experts recommend:
– Daily Dosage: 15–30 mg per day (consult a healthcare provider for personalized advice).
– Best Time to Take: With meals to improve absorption and minimize stomach upset.
– Forms Available: Tablets, lozenges, and liquid supplements.
Who Should Take Zinc Gluconate?
– Individuals prone to frequent colds
– Those with zinc-deficient diets (vegetarians, elderly)
– People under high stress or recovering from illness
